Description

Experience professional-grade HDMI distribution with the Manhattan 4K HDMI HDBaseT over Ethernet Extender Kit. Built for reliability in classrooms, conference rooms, retail environments, and home theaters, this kit leverages HDBaseT technology to extend high-quality HDMI signals over a single Ethernet cable. It delivers 4K at 30 Hz up to 40 meters (130 feet) and 1080p up to 70 meters (230 feet), while carrying multi-channel audio, Ethernet, and control signals with ease. The result is a clean, scalable solution that minimizes cabling clutter and simplifies long-distance AV deployment.

Designed to meet the needs of demanding AV installations, the Manhattan extender supports Power over Cable (PoC), allowing power to travel with the signal via the CATx cable where PoE capabilities exist, reducing the need for multiple power adapters. With IR and RS232 control pass-through, you can manage sources and displays from a distance or integrate the system into broader automation and control ecosystems. The kit emphasizes robust EDID management and wide compatibility across HDMI sources and displays, ensuring reliable startup, synchronization, and consistent image quality even in challenging environments.

  • 4K HDR-ready extension up to 40 m (130 ft): Transmits 4K at 30 Hz with solid color fidelity and smooth motion from the source to the display over a single Ethernet cable, preserving clarity and detail.
  • 1080p extension up to 70 m (230 ft): Flexible long-distance support for Full HD content, ideal for larger rooms, multi-seat setups, and installations where distance is a premium.
  • Power over Cable (PoC) and streamlined wiring: Send power alongside data over the CATx link when compatible, reducing wall clutter and minimizing the number of wall sockets and power adapters required.
  • IR and RS232 control pass-through: Preserve remote control capabilities and integrate with automation systems, enabling centralized control of displays, players, and other AV gear.
  • HDBaseT compatibility and plug-and-play setup: Designed for quick installations with auto EDID management and broad compatibility across HDMI sources and displays, delivering a reliable, user-friendly experience.

how to install Manhattan 4K HDMI HDBaseT over Ethernet Extender Kit

Planning a clean, reliable installation starts with understanding how the Manhattan extender fits into your AV workflow. This setup is ideal for scenarios where you want a single-cable solution that preserves high video quality while enabling remote control and centralized power management. By following these steps, you’ll maximize performance, minimize troubleshooting, and ensure a seamless user experience for your audience or household needs.

  • Power down all devices before connecting cables to prevent any signal handshake issues or potential equipment harm. This also helps EDID negotiation initialize properly once power is restored.
  • Connect the HDMI source (such as a Blu-ray player, computer, or media player) to the transmitter’s HDMI input using a high-quality HDMI cable that supports 4K at 30 Hz with the color depth you require.
  • Link the receiver to the display (TV, monitor, or projector) by connecting the receiver’s HDMI output to the display’s HDMI input with another reliable HDMI cable. Ensure the display is set to the correct input to receive the signal.
  • Run a single Cat6/Cat6a Ethernet cable between the transmitter and receiver. Use a shielded category cable to minimize interference and preserve signal integrity, especially in environments with multiple electrical devices or wireless equipment.
  • Power the transmitter and receiver. If your environment supports Power over Cable (PoC) or PoE, you may rely on a power source on one end to feed both units through the CATx link. If PoC isn’t available or supported, connect the included power adapters to each unit as directed by the user manual.
  • Configure IR and RS232 control if you plan to manage devices remotely or integrate with a control system. Place the IR receiver or emitter in the recommended line-of-sight path for the remote and connect RS232 cables to the appropriate ports on your automation hub or device.
  • Test the setup. Power on your source and display, switch to the correct input, and verify that 4K video (or 1080p, depending on your content) appears clearly with synchronized audio. If issues arise, re-check cable quality, EDID settings, and ensure the correct HDBaseT mode is active on both ends.

Frequently asked questions

  • What resolutions does the Manhattan 4K HDMI HDBaseT over Ethernet Extender Kit support? It supports 4K at 30 Hz over distances up to 40 meters (130 feet) and 1080p up to 70 meters (230 feet). Resolution performance can vary with cable quality, source capabilities, and display compatibility, but the kit is designed to preserve image fidelity across supported modes via HDBaseT.
  • How far can I extend a 4K signal? Up to 40 meters (about 130 feet) over a single Ethernet CATx cable when transmitting 4K at 30 Hz. Distances may vary based on cabling, shielding, and environmental factors such as interference or conduit routing.
  • Is Power over Cable supported? Yes. The kit offers PoC functionality, enabling power to be delivered over the CATx link when used with compatible PoE infrastructure, which reduces the need for separate power bricks and simplifies installation.
  • Do I get IR or RS232 control? Yes. The extender provides IR pass-through for remote control and RS232 connectivity for integration with automation or control systems, maintaining centralized or remote operation capabilities.
  • What cables should I use for the best performance? Use a high-quality Cat6 or Cat6a Ethernet cable, ideally shielded, to maximize signal integrity for 4K content and longer runs, and to minimize interference from other devices and networks.
